What is the difference between Virtual Medical Billing Coding Training vs Medical Coding Specialist?

AspectVirtual Medical Billing Coding TrainingMedical Coding Specialist
CredentialsTypically includes certification prep, training programs, and coursesRequires coding certifications like CPC or CCS
Work EnvironmentOnline or remote learning environmentHealthcare facilities, medical offices, or remote work
Employer & Industry UsageTraining providers, online education platformsHospitals, clinics, insurance companies
Search & Comparison IntentLearning pathway, training programs, certification prepJob roles, certification requirements, career info

Virtual Medical Billing Coding Training provides the foundational knowledge and skills needed to start a career in medical billing and coding, often through online courses. A Medical Coding Specialist is a certified professional who applies coding standards in healthcare settings. While training prepares you for the role, certification and experience are essential for employment as a Medical Coding Specialist.

Job description

Moore OB/GYN is seeking an experienced and detail-oriented Certified Medical Billing & Coding Specialist to join our growing team. The ideal candidate will have strong OB/GYN coding knowledge, payer compliance expertise, and the ability to manage accounts receivable efficiently.
Position: Certified Medical Biller/Coder
Employment Type: Full-Time
Location: Forestville โ€“ Maryland
Key Responsibilities:
  • Accurate CPT, ICD-10, and HCPCS coding (OB/GYN focus)
  • Review and submission of claims (commercial, Medicaid MCOs MD/DC )
  • Manage denials, appeals, and AR follow-up
  • Verify patient eligibility and benefits
  • Ensure compliance with payer policies (UHC, CareFirst, JHHP, MD/DC Medicaid, etc.)
  • Work within EMR/PM systemย 
  • Apply appropriate modifiers (25, 59, 51, etc.)
  • Monitor payer updates and policy changes
Qualifications:
  • CPC, CCS, or equivalent certification (Required)
  • Minimum 5 years medical billing/coding experience
  • OB/GYN experience strongly preferred
  • Knowledge of CMS-1500 claims
  • Strong understanding of Medicaid and MCO billing guidelines
  • Excellent communication and problem-solving skills
Preferred Skills:
  • Experience with ultrasound and preventive + problem visit coding
  • Familiarity with AR workflow optimization
  • Knowledge of Maryland/DC payer compliance
